Core Insights - Apple's FY24Q4 revenue reached $94.93 billion, a year-over-year increase of 6.1%, driven by iPhone, iPad, Mac, and services, while wearables/home/accessories saw a decline [3][4]. - AMD's Q3 revenue was $6.819 billion, up 18% year-over-year, with an upward revision of its annual AI chip revenue guidance to $5 billion [9][10]. Summary by Sections Apple Performance - FY24Q4 revenue was $94.93 billion, matching expectations, with a gross margin of 46.2% [3][4]. - Net profit was $14.736 billion, down 35.8% year-over-year due to a one-time tax expense of $10.2 billion [3][4]. - FY25Q1 guidance indicates low single-digit percentage growth, reflecting potential production cuts for the iPhone 16 series [3][4]. Product Breakdown - Product revenue was $69.96 billion, a 4.1% year-over-year increase, with iPhone revenue at $46.222 billion, up 5.5% year-over-year [4][6]. - Service revenue reached $24.972 billion, a historical high, with an 11.9% year-over-year growth [6][7]. Regional Performance - Revenue from the Greater China region showed a narrowing decline, while other regions experienced growth [6][7]. - Year-over-year revenue growth in the U.S., Europe, and other regions was 3.9%, 11.0%, and 16.6%, respectively [6][7]. AMD Performance - AMD's Q3 revenue was $6.819 billion, with a gross margin of 54% [9][10]. - The data center business saw a significant increase, with revenue of $3.549 billion, up 122% year-over-year [10][11]. - Client segment revenue was $1.881 billion, up 29% year-over-year, driven by the fifth-generation Ryzen CPU sales [13][14]. AI and Future Outlook - Apple is focusing on AI integration, with the iOS 18.1 upgrade rate doubling compared to the previous version [7]. - AMD's AI chip revenue guidance was raised to $5 billion, primarily driven by the MI300X for inference workloads [9][11].
